David James will lead us to a butterfly paradise at 6000-7000 ft in late July with 25-35 species in flowery meadows and on rocky slopes. Expect to hike up to 5 miles roundtrip from where we park. Participants won't need to do the entire length if they choose not to. A summer home of Coronis Fritillaries along with Hydaspe, Zerene and Arctic Fritillaries. Arctic Blues and a high elevation form of Lupine Blue may be seen on the upper slopes. Saturday, July 26th, is forecast to be sunny and in the sixties.
